SchoolRow ranks Zion-Benton Twnshp Hi Sch 524th of 601 Illinois high schools for 2024–25, based on Illinois Report Card 2024–25 English and Math results — better than 13% of high schools statewide. Its statewide percentile went from 28th in 2019 to 13th in 2025 — declining.

What school district is Zion-Benton Twnshp Hi Sch in?

Zion-Benton Twnshp Hi Sch is part of the Zion-Benton Twp HSD 126 district in Zion, Illinois.

Is Zion-Benton Twnshp Hi Sch a good school?

SchoolRow ranks Zion-Benton Twnshp Hi Sch 524th of 601 Illinois high schools (better than 13% statewide) based on 2024–25 test results (Illinois Report Card 2024–25).

What is the racial makeup of Zion-Benton Twnshp Hi Sch?

Hispanic 55%, Black 23%, White 14%, Two or more races 5% (2,159 students, 2023–24).
